Solar ground leases can last between 15 and 30 years with most lasting around 20 to 25 years which coincides with the useful life expectancy of solar pv panels.

Depending on field access one of those smaller fields may no longer be accessible if a solar project is constructed in the middle of the existing large field.
The solar company may only end up leasing a portion of the property and then as a land owner you could be left with two small fields with a solar farm in the middle.
